Study on the Effect of Nasal Drip Immunization on the Trachea Function of SPF Chicken

Abstract: In order to study the effect of nasal drip immunization on tracheal function of chickens,tracheal cilia swing rate,tracheal morphology and mucus secretion after nasal drip immunization with Newcastle disease vaccine in SPF chickens were studied.Eighty 7-day-old SPF chickens were randomly divided into control group and test group,40 chickens in each group.The test group received nasal immunization with attenuated Newcastle disease vaccine and the control group received nasal saline.At 0,2,4 and 6 days post immunization,10 chickens were killed randomly in each group.Tracheal cilia swing rate was measured by red blood cell tracer method.Paraffin tissue sections were collected from trachea for HE and Alcian Blue pH 2.5 and pH 1.0 staining.The results showed that the cilia swing rate of SPF chickens in test group was higher than that in control group at 0 and 2 d post immunization,but the difference was not significant (P>0.05).After nasal drip immunization,the trachea structure of SPF chickens was intact without obvious damage.After nasal drip immunization,the distribution volume of acid mucus in trachea of SPF chickens in test group was significantly higher than that of control group at 0 and 2 d post immunization (P<0.05),then decreased significantly,and increased at 6 d post immunization,but the difference was not significant (P>0.05).The distribution volume of sulfated mucus increased significantly at 0 and 2 d post immunization (P<0.05),and then decreased in accordance with the control group.The results showed that the tracheal mucus secretion of SPF chickens increased in two days after nasal drip immunization,and then returned to normal level.There was no significant effect of immunization on tracheal morphology and cilia swing rate.
